Which term describes an injury caused by medical management that prolongs hospitalization or causes disability?

Explanation:
This item tests understanding of safety terminology for harm that occurs as a result of medical care. An adverse event is harm to a patient that arises from the medical management itself, not from the patient’s underlying condition. Because the injury is linked to the care provided, it often prolongs hospitalization or leads to new or worsened disability. This is what makes adverse events the best fit for the description. Accountability refers to who is responsible, not the harm itself. Chain of command describes the organizational path for communication and authority, not the patient harm outcome. An error is a mistake in a process or action; while an error can cause harm, the term adverse event specifically captures injury caused by medical management leading to extended stay or disability.
